Barakat Name Meaning and Origin

The name Barakat means "blessings" or "auspiciousness." It signifies divine grace, prosperity, and abundance. What does Barakat mean? It embodies the idea of being blessed and fortunate. Barakat is a female name of unknown origin. Its use is culturally significant in some communities, reflecting a hope for a blessed and prosperous life for the child.
